Can fuel additives really save fuel? Fuel additives are a very general term. Just looking at the chemical additives, they can be divided into anti-knock agents, metal passivators, anti-icing agents, anti-gluing agents, and anti-knock agents according to different functions. There are more than a dozen types of electrostatic agents, anti-wear agents, flow improvers, smoke suppressants, combustion accelerants, surfactants, bactericides, etc. Some of these additives reduce the waste of fuel by cleaning the carburetor or unclogging the fuel injector and improving the fluidity of the fuel; while additives such as combustion accelerants directly participate in the physical and chemical reactions of the fuel in the engine cylinder, making the fuel burn. Completed at the same time, the efficiency of the engine can be effectively improved. Therefore, fuel additives can still play a role in saving fuel. How to use additives With the development of the petrochemical industry, some additives that can clean carburetors and fuel injectors have been added in the production of some refined oils, and usually do not require car owners to purchase additional additives for use.
Most of the chemical additives currently on the market are combinations of several functional substances, which only strengthen the effects of certain aspects. In terms of fuel additive products, my country has only one non-mandatory standard formulated in 1999 and lacks unified industry standards. Fuel additives themselves are a good industry that benefits the country and the people, but the problem of "scattered and poor quality" in the market is quite prominent. As far as our reporter has learned, there are more than 400 brands of additives in my country, of which there is a mix of good and bad. The main ingredients in some chemical additives are themselves restricted ingredients in fuel, such as lead, manganese, iron, silicon, olefins, sulfur, phosphorus, etc.
Excessive addition of these substances will destroy the quality of the original fuel, and additives containing sulfur and phosphorus substances may simultaneously generate strong carcinogens and be emitted with the exhaust, forming highly toxic emissions.

According to his understanding, most of the genuine additives currently sold on the market do no damage to the car itself. The key is the effect. . The use of chemical additives requires extra care. Due to the wide variety and complex composition of chemical additives, chemical reactions between some additives can produce adverse effects. Therefore, do not use more than two additives at the same time before knowing the composition and chemical properties of the additives used.
In addition, since different fuel brands have different oil compositions and have different interactions with fuel additives, even if an additive is added to a certain brand of oil, it does play a very good role. However, switching to another gas station to use fuel produced by another company may also cause negative effects such as sedimentation, oil line blockage, increased stalling times, reduced power, and increased fuel consumption. Therefore, before using chemical additives, you must not only consult experienced car owners about the additive itself, but also know the fuel brands and types that "cooperate well" with it. 1. Generally, additives with physical properties do not change the composition of the fuel, so they will not be corrosive to the car engine.
2. Read the additive instructions carefully. Do not use additives containing metal particles. Because additives containing metal particles may have adverse reactions when added to cars using three-way catalytic converters, and in severe cases may cause the three-way catalytic converter to fail.
3. Check whether the product has passed through formal channels and whether there is a test report from a national authority. Pay special attention to imported products.
